About
Twenty Technologies, Inc. , based in Arlington, US, specializes in advanced cyber capabilities, delivering systems that empower the U. S. and allied nations to effectively deter and respond to cyber threats in real-time operational scenarios.
Founded in 2024 in Arlington, US, Twenty Technologies, Inc. focuses on providing advanced cyber solutions for modern conflict. The company raised USD 38. 00 mn in Series A funding on November 20, 2025, led by Caffeinated Capital with participation from General Catalyst Partners and In-Q-Tel, marking a pivotal moment in its growth strategy.
The firm has conducted one deal to date, emphasizing its position in the cybersecurity landscape. Twenty specializes in advanced cyber capabilities designed specifically for modern conflict, providing enterprise-grade systems that enable the U. S. and its allies to effectively deter and defeat adversaries in real-time scenarios.
The company’s core offerings focus on delivering automated cyber operations that significantly enhance operational efficiency by transforming traditionally manual workflows into continuous, automated processes across numerous targets. These products integrate elite tradecraft into their technology, ensuring adaptability and reliability under the challenging conditions of cyber warfare. Target markets for these services extend beyond the U. S.
, encompassing allied nations engaged in cyber defense and offensive operations, including countries in NATO and other strategic partnerships. Clients primarily include government agencies, defense contractors, and military organizations requiring robust, scalable software solutions to maintain cybersecurity and operational superiority. Twenty generates revenue through direct business-to-business transactions, primarily involving the sale of software subscriptions and partnerships that focus on delivering tailored cyber solutions. Clients engage in agreements that typically include multi-year contracts, where revenue is recognized on a subscription basis, reflecting the ongoing delivery of services and software updates.
The company’s flagship offerings, backed by its unique operational expertise, cater to the defense sector, where clients require immediate access to cutting-edge capabilities. The structure of these transactions often involves tiered pricing plans that correspond to the scale of operations and specific needs of the client, allowing for flexibility and scalability in service deployment. The nature of these transactions underscores a commitment to performance and results, with revenue directly tied to the successful implementation of systems that enhance the cyber capabilities of the armed forces and allied nations. In November 2025, Twenty Technologies, Inc.
raised USD 38 mn in Series A funding, which the company plans to utilize for expanding operations and enhancing its development efforts. The firm aims to launch new products designed to address the evolving demands of cyber warfare and expects to target additional markets within NATO and allied nations by 2026, facilitating broader access to their advanced capabilities.
